When should I seek local service for a Mazda-specific warning light, like the check engine light?

Seek immediate diagnostic service at a local shop if the light is flashing, indicating a severe misfire that could damage the catalytic converter, especially important given our mountainous roads. A solid light still warrants a prompt check to prevent a minor issue from becoming a major repair, as modern Mazda engines are complex.

What local driving conditions should influence my Mazda's maintenance schedule in Lone Mountain?

The steep, winding roads around Lone Mountain and Cumberland Gap necessitate more frequent inspections of brakes, tires, and suspension components. Additionally, preparing your cooling system for summer heat and your battery for cold mountain winters is essential to avoid common seasonal breakdowns.
